In addition to the slope upgrading programme, the highway slope owner should<br />

develop a slope preventive maintenance programme integrated with it and taking into account<br />

the findings from routine maintenance inspections and Engineer Inspections for Maintenance.<br />

Information obtained from the maintenance inspections, e.g. changes in slope or road usage<br />

condition, should be reviewed to reassess the priority of the slope for upgrading or preventive<br />

maintenance under the integrated programme.<br />

Warning signs should be erected at those roadside slopes that have been confirmed by<br />

stability assessments to be substandard and included in a slope upgrading or preventive<br />

maintenance programme (see Figure E2 in Appendix E).
